Complaint: Secrecy
Ok so let me start by saying I love this game. A classic style naruto game is always fun to come back to but...
The secrecy in this game needs to die in a fire. Why keep all these jutsu secret from everyone? What does this gain? Keeping the requirements for a jutsu only serves push new players away from your game or the clan you keep secret. The prime example would be NinTai's Ippon V2. If a jutsu is so powerful that you can't tell people how to get it that's a balance issue NOT a reason to keep new players from obtaining the jutsu. By limiting the jutsu only to the few players that know the requirements you basically limit tournament winners or powerful players to those who already know the requirement. I understand having powerful jutsus being difficult to obtain or only a chance to get but keeping it secret like this is hurting the player base. I would suggest if the jutsu is strong enough that you want to limit make it a mission style thing with only a limited number of tries and if you don't complete the mission then you dont get the jutsu. This eliminates the need for a secret. Everyone has their chance to get the jutsu and if they fail then too bad. I understand the downside of this. This would lead to people remaking if they lose or fail. Make the requirements high enough that remaking would be a pain but let the requirements be known.
TLDR: Secret reqs drive noobs away please fix that.
